<p>mySQLi를 처음 사용해 보았습니다. 루프의 경우에는 이렇게 했습니다. 루프의 결과가 표시되지만 단일 레코드를 표시하려고 하면 중단됩니다. 다음은 작업 루프 코드입니다. </p>
<pre class="brush:php;toolbar:false;"><?php
// 데이터베이스에 연결
$hostname="로컬호스트";
$database="mydb이름";
$사용자 이름="루트";
$password="";
$conn = mysqli_connect($hostname, $username, $password, $database);
?>
사용
으아아아mysqli_fetch_row()
. 다음 코드를 사용해 보세요:결과가 하나만 필요한 경우 루프를 사용할 필요가 없습니다. 행을 직접 가져옵니다.
전체 데이터 행을 연관 배열로 가져와야 하는 경우:
으아아아하나의 값만 필요한 경우 PHP 8.2부터 시작하세요.
으아아아또는 이전 버전의 경우:
으아아아다음은 다양한 사용 사례의 전체 예입니다
쿼리에 사용되는 변수
쿼리에서 변수를 사용해야 하는 경우 전처리된 문을 사용해야 합니다. 예를 들어 변수
이 있다고 가정해 보겠습니다.$id
:PHP >= 8.2
으아아아PHP의 이전 버전:
으아아아위 과정에 대한 자세한 설명은 제 기사에서 확인하실 수 있습니다. 이 프로세스를 따라야 하는 이유는 유명한 질문에 설명되어 있습니다.
쿼리에 변수가 없습니다
귀하의 경우 쿼리에 변수가 사용되지 않았으므로
을 사용할 수 있습니다. 으아아아query()
방법: